Subject: Quickstore 4.2 — bloom filter now fronts the KV layer

Plugin authors: starting with this release, Quickstore places a bloom filter ahead of the key-value store. Negative lookups return faster; false positives fall through safely. No API changes are required on your side. Verify your plugin against the staging build referenced below.

session token of fahif-tadup = htk3_9c7

### Runbook: SDK Parity Check (Fennick Client Libraries)

Before sign-off, run the parity harness against both the Koa-style JavaScript SDK and the Python SDK for the Fennick gateway. The harness diffs exposed methods, auth flows, and retry defaults — security reviewers mostly care about the auth flows, since the Python client historically lagged on token refresh. Anything flagged "divergent" blocks release; "cosmetic" diffs are fine. If you need to escalate, grab the parity report from the artifacts tab and quote the token below.

trace token, fafog-kageg: htk4_98e6

## Break-Glass Access — FeedCheck Validator

If the PodLint queue locks up and nobody from the Castaway crew is around, you can force-unlock the FeedCheck admin console yourself. Don't do this casually — it bypasses audit hooks, so file an incident note afterward. To open the break-glass vault, use the recovery passphrase below.

unlock words, kahif-bajep: druix-sormir-fenys